Select the correct answer. based on the genotype of ab blood, what relationship do the a and b genes have?

Based on the genotype of AB blood, the a and b genes are codominant.

Since both A and B antigens are equally prevalent on red blood cells, the A and B genes are related in a codominant manner.

<h3>What is gene?</h3>
  • A gene is a fundamental building block of heredity and a DNA sequence of nucleotides that codes for the production of a gene product, either RNA or protein.
  • DNA is initially transcribed into RNA during gene expression.
  • The RNA may execute a specific function directly or may serve as an intermediary template for a protein.
<h3>What is codominance?</h3>
  • In terms of genetics, codominance is a sort of inheritance in which two distinct expressions (alleles) of the same gene result in distinct features in a person.
  • Animals that exhibit codominance include roan cattle and speckled chickens, which have alleles that express both red and white hair as well as both black and white feathers.
  • Plants also exhibit codominance.
